- Title
- Presbytery of Philadelphia minutes, 1706-1746.
- Description
- First Presbytery of Philadelphia minute book, 1706-1717; 1733-1746; with letter book, 1708-1720. The Presbytery of Philadelphia was the first presbytery in the American colonies, organized by Francis Makemie and six other ministers.

- Title
- Not Much To Do, 1966.
- Description
- Film made by six 11 to 14 year old boys living in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ania--Barry Griffen, James Lucas, Ronald Mapp, Luerell Mapp, Michael Watters, Howard White--who were taught to shoot, develop and edit film. In 1966, Robert D. Stoddard, a recent graduate of Princeton Theological Seminary and assistant pastor at Tabernacle Presbyterian Church (Philadelphia, Pa.), developed the Tabernacle Film Club for West Philadelphia children of junior high school age. Stoddard's initial notion was to have the children film adaptations of Bible stories. A professor at the University of Pennsylvania's Annenberg School of Communication, Sol Worth, advised Stoddard to let the children simply roam with the camera. Funding for the project was raised from the Board of Christian Education and from the Presbyterian Women's Thank Offering. An Annenberg student, Ben Achtenberg, served as director. "Not Much To Do" premiered at the Annenberg School on Monday, November 14, 1966.
